Temporomandibular joint (TMJ) disorders, also known as TMD, are a significant source of discomfort and frustration for many individuals. These disorders can cause pain in the jaw joint, difficulty opening the mouth, and clicking or popping sounds when moving the jaw. TMJ disorders can stem from several factors, including teeth grinding, misalignment in the jaw, and even stress. It is crucial to address TMJ-related pain effectively, as untreated TMJ disorders can lead to further complications and severely impact one's quality of life.

Understanding Multiwave Locked System (MLS) Laser Therapy


As an innovative, non-invasive treatment option, Multiwave Locked System (MLS) Laser Therapy utilizes state-of-the-art laser technology to alleviate pain, reduce inflammation, and promote healing. It combines two synchronized laser beams, one in the continuous emission mode and the other in the pulsed mode, to produce uniquely synchronized wavelengths that interact with the patient's tissue. This synergistic action enhances treatment outcomes and accelerates the healing process without the need for drugs or surgery.


The MLS Laser Therapy is particularly effective in managing TMJ disorders due to its ability to target the specific area of discomfort, delivering highly controlled and accurate therapeutic energy to the inflamed tissues surrounding the temporomandibular joint. This precise targeting facilitates a reduction in swelling, which in turn alleviates the pain and discomfort associated with TMJ disorders.


Key Benefits of MLS Laser Therapy for TMJ Disorders


Multiwave Locked System (MLS) Laser Therapy offers various benefits when it comes to addressing the pain and discomfort associated with TMJ disorders. These include:


1. Non-invasive: Unlike surgery or other invasive treatment options, MLS Laser Therapy is entirely non-invasive. It promotes healing and alleviates pain without any incisions or prolonged recovery time.


2. Painless: The treatment process is pain-free, allowing patients to experience relief without discomfort during the therapy sessions.


3. Precise targeting: The advanced technology behind MLS Laser Therapy ensures accurate targeting of the inflamed temporomandibular joint tissues, resulting in efficient and targeted pain relief.


4. Reduced Inflammation: MLS Laser Therapy effectively reduces inflammation, which is often the primary cause of discomfort and pain in TMJ disorders.


5. Accelerated healing: By stimulating blood flow and cellular activity, MLS Laser Therapy promotes the natural healing process and enhances tissue repair.


The MLS Laser Therapy Treatment Process


The MLS Laser Therapy treatment process begins with a thorough evaluation of the patient's specific TMJ-related concerns. This assessment ensures that the therapy's laser parameters are customized according to each patient's unique needs and condition.


During the treatment sessions, patients are comfortably seated in a dental chair while the laser device is positioned above the targeted area. The device, which is connected to a highly specialized control unit, emits synchronized laser beams that penetrate through the skin to reach the inflamed tissues. The laser energy promotes healing and reduces inflammation, alleviating the pain associated with TMJ disorders.


Each session typically lasts between 10 to 15 minutes and can be conducted either as a standalone treatment or in conjunction with other therapies. The number of sessions required will depend on the severity of the TMJ disorder and the patient's response to the treatment. Progress is continually monitored during follow-up appointments, allowing our professionals to tailor the treatment plan to the patient's ongoing needs.


Complementary Treatments and Lifestyle Changes for TMJ Disorders


Aside from MLS Laser Therapy, additional treatments, and lifestyle modifications can be employed to support TMJ disorder management effectively. These complementary approaches may include:


1. Oral appliances: Customized dental devices, such as bite guards or splints, can help reposition the jaw and alleviate the strain on the temporomandibular joint, reducing discomfort.


2. Physical therapy: Exercises and techniques aimed at improving jaw mobility, strengthening the muscles, and promoting relaxation can complement the benefits of MLS Laser Therapy.


3. Medications: Over-the-counter anti-inflammatory medication or prescription muscle relaxants can provide temporary relief from TMJ-related pain. However, it's vital to consult with a healthcare professional before using any medication.


4. Stress reduction: As stress can contribute to the development or exacerbation of TMJ disorders, incorporating stress management techniques, such as meditation, yoga, or mindfulness practices, can be beneficial for managing TMJ-related pain.


5. Self-care habits: Simple practices, such as maintaining proper posture and avoiding excessive gum chewing or teeth clenching, can help to reduce strain on the temporomandibular joint and alleviate discomfort.
